As for cages, Martins cages are really good quality..I have a mammoth cage called a Ferret Nation #142.  Its is the size of a refrigerator. I had 4 males in it (big males) Small rats and babies could get  out between the bars but you can add hardware cloth to them. It is so big  but its so easy to clean.
